Python 3 支持性检测工具 Py3Readiness 使用指南
基础介绍
Py3Readiness 是一个开源项目,旨在帮助开发者检查 Python 3 对最流行的 Python 库和包的支持情况。该项目通过分析 requirements.txt
文件,告诉用户哪些包支持 Python 3,哪些不支持。该项目使用了 Python 和 HTML 作为主要的编程语言。
新手常见问题及解决步骤
问题一:如何安装和运行 Py3Readiness?
解决步骤:
- 克隆或下载项目到本地计算机。
- 进入项目目录,运行
pip install -r requirements.txt
安装项目依赖。 - 在项目目录中运行
python generate.py
生成支持性报告。 - 打开生成的 HTML 文件(通常是
index.html
),查看结果。
问题二:如何将 Py3Readiness 部署到自己的服务器?
解决步骤:
- 确保服务器已安装 Python 和必要的依赖。
- 将项目文件上传到服务器。
- 配置服务器以运行
generate.py
脚本,例如使用 cron job 实现定期更新。 - 将生成的 HTML 文件放置在 web 服务器的可访问目录中。
问题三:如何为 Py3Readiness 添加新的包支持性检测?
解决步骤:
- 在
generate.py
文件中找到处理包支持性检测的部分。 - 添加新的包名称和对应的支持性检测逻辑。
- 确保更新了
requirements.txt
文件,包括任何新依赖。 - 运行
generate.py
脚本测试新添加的包是否正确检测。
通过遵循上述步骤,新手用户可以更加顺利地使用 Py3Readiness 项目,并解决在使用过程中可能遇到的问题。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考